What Does German B1 Level Signify?
At the B1 level, learners are anticipated to manage the majority of interaction jobs experienced while traveling, living, or operating in a German-speaking environment. The CEFR specifies a [B1 Certificate German](http://121.41.2.71:3000/b1-sprachzertifikat-deutsch7257) learner as someone who can:
Understand the primary points of clear basic input on familiar matters frequently experienced in work, school, and leisure.Handle the majority of situations most likely to emerge while taking a trip in a location where the language is spoken.Produce simple connected text on subjects that are familiar or of personal interest.Describe experiences and occasions, dreams, hopes, and aspirations, and briefly provide factors and explanations for opinions and plans.The Importance of the B1 Certificate
For numerous global citizens in Germany, Austria, or Switzerland, the B1 certificate is more than simply an evidence of linguistic capability; it is a legal and professional requirement.
1. Requirements for Citizenship and Residency
The B1 certificate is regularly the minimum requirement for obtaining a permanent home authorization (Niederlassungserlaubnis) or obtaining German citizenship (Einbürgerung). It functions as legal evidence that the person has incorporated sufficiently to manage separately in society.
2. Work and Vocational Training
While lots of top-level business roles need B2 or C1 proficiency, a B1 certificate is typically the entry secret for numerous employment training programs (Ausbildung) and service-oriented tasks. It demonstrates to employers that the prospect can follow directions and communicate with associates and consumers.
3. Preparation for Higher Education
For students preparing to attend a Studienkolleg (preparatory college) in Germany, a B1 or B2 certificate is usually a necessary requirement for admission.
The Structure of the B1 Exam
The most recognized B1 evaluations are those provided by the Goethe-Institut, telc (The European Language Certificates), and the ÖSD (Österreichisches Sprachdiplom Deutsch). While there are minor variations, the modular structure stays mainly consistent across these companies.
Table 1: Overview of the B1 Examination Modules (Goethe/ ÖSD Model)ModulePeriodDescriptionGoalReading (Lesen)65 Minutes5 parts with 30 tasks (numerous option, matching).Comprehending blog site posts, e-mails, ads, and news.Listening (Hören)40 Minutes4 parts with different workouts (True/False, multiple choice).Recording essential info from announcements, radio clips, and discussions.Composing (Schreiben)60 Minutes3 jobs: Informal e-mail, official action, and an opinion piece.Revealing ideas and managing correspondence.Speaking (Sprechen)15 MinutesNormally in pairs: Plan an event together, offer a brief presentation.Utilizing the language interactively and descriptively.Deep Dive into the Four Modules1. Reading (Lesen)
Candidates must process various types of texts. One part might involve matching individuals's interests with particular advertisements (Requirement: Scanning), while another may require a deep understanding of a long-form short article concerning a social problem (Requirement: Identifying detail).
2. Listening (Hören)
The listening area checks the capability to comprehend spoken German in various contexts. This consists of public statements at a train station, private conversations in a café, and a radio interview or lecture. Precision is important, as the recordings are often played only when.
3. Composing (Schreiben)
The writing module is divided into 3 distinct obstacles:
Task 1: An informal message to a buddy (approx. 80 words).Task 2: A reaction to a post or social networks remark where one should express an opinion (approx. 80 words).Job 3: An official apology or demand to a remarkable or landlord (approx. 40 words).4. Speaking (Sprechen)
The speaking exam is often considered the most stressful. It includes:
Part 1: Planning something together. 2 prospects should organize an event, such as a birthday party or a weekend trip, talking about dates, costs, and tasks.Part 2: A short discussion. The prospect provides on a particular subject (e.g., "Is organic food worth it?").Part 3: Questions and Answers. The prospect responses questions from the inspector and the other prospect concerning their discussion.Scoring and Passing Requirements
To pass the modular examinations (like the Goethe-Zertifikat B1), a candidate must attain at least 60% in each of the four modules.
Table 2: B1 Scoring Breakdown (Example per Module)Score RangeGradeResult90-- 100Great (Sehr gut)Pass80-- 89Good (Gut)Pass70-- 79Satisfying (Befriedigend)Pass60-- 69Enough (Ausreichend)Pass0-- 59Insufficient (Nicht bestanden)Fail
Keep in mind: In the modular system, if a prospect fails one module, they just require to retake that specific module rather than the whole exam.
Strategies for Preparation
Preparation for the B1 exam need to be methodical and cover all 4 linguistic proficiencies. Learners typically find the jump from A2 to B1 challenging because it needs a shift from memorized phrases to spontaneous sentence construction.
Vital Study Lists

Subjunctions: Using weil, obwohl, damit, dass to produce complicated sentences.Passive Voice: Understanding how to explain processes (Das Auto wird repariert).Adjective Declension: Mastering endings in various cases (Nominative, Accusative, Dative, Genitive).Reflexive Verbs: Correct use of verbs like sich freuen or sich interessieren.Prepositions with Genitive: Using trotz, während, and wegen.

Various companies serve various needs. While all are typically recognized, some distinctions exist:
Goethe-Institut: The gold standard worldwide. Their certificates are acknowledged by all authorities and educational institutions.telc: Often slightly more inexpensive and often utilized by combination courses (Integrationskurse) in Germany. They use specialized examinations like "telc Deutsch B1-B2 Beruf."ÖSD: The primary certificate for those relocating to or studying in Austria, though it is recognized throughout the German-speaking world.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)How long does it require to reach the B1 level?
Typically, it takes in between 350 to 600 hours of intensive study to reach B1 efficiency from an overall novice level. This can differ based upon the student's prior language experience and the intensity of their courses.
Is the B1 certificate legitimate permanently?
Yes, for most functions, the B1 certificate does not expire. However, some companies or immigration offices might ask for a certificate that is no older than 2 years to ensure the candidate's abilities are still present.
Can I take the modules separately?
In the Goethe-[Zertifikat B1](http://8.140.232.131:8100/b1-zertifikat5519) and ÖSD B1, the modules (Reading, Listening, Writing, Speaking) can be taken and passed individually. If a prospect passes 2 modules in May and the remaining two in June, they will get a full certificate.
What is the distinction in between B1 and the "Deutsch-Test für Zuwanderer" (DTZ)?
The DTZ is a particular scaled test (A2-B1) utilized at the end of combination courses in Germany. It is somewhat various in format than the standard Goethe or telc B1 exams but is similarly legitimate for residency and citizenship applications.
Just how much does the B1 test expense?
The cost differs depending upon the supplier and the place, but it generally varies in between EUR130 and EUR220 for the complete test. Private modules can be booked for a smaller sized cost.
